Understanding UK GAAP and Its Importance

UK GAAP represents the framework that governs how companies prepare and present their financial statements in the United Kingdom. It ensures uniformity clarity and comparability across financial reporting which in turn enhances trust among investors and regulators. The current structure of UK GAAP aligns closely with international standards but still maintains specific national requirements tailored to UK businesses.

Complying with UK GAAP goes beyond meeting legal mandates it demonstrates the company’s commitment to sound governance and financial integrity. As financial audits increasingly emphasize compliance accuracy and disclosure companies that remain aligned with updated standards minimize risks of audit qualifications and regulatory penalties. Key Features of FRS 102

FRS 102 forms the central component of UK GAAP for most entities excluding small micro and certain public interest entities that fall under different frameworks. It provides detailed guidance on recognizing measuring presenting and disclosing various financial elements such as assets liabilities income and expenses.

Some of the key features include

  1. Simplified Framework Designed to be more concise and practical compared to previous standards.

  2. Fair Value Measurement Encourages transparent valuation of financial instruments and investments.

  3. Revenue Recognition Outlines detailed principles for timing and measurement of income.

  4. Disclosure Requirements Improves clarity for users of financial statements.

  5. Leases and Financial Instruments Provides updated recognition criteria to reflect economic reality.

Common Challenges in Meeting FRS 102 Compliance

Despite its structured approach FRS 102 implementation presents challenges especially for organizations transitioning from older frameworks or adopting it for the first time. Some common issues include complexity in fair value measurement difficulties in lease accounting and confusion regarding related-party disclosures. Additionally interpreting the guidance on revenue recognition can be difficult for businesses with multiple revenue streams.
